Ignition Repair

You require immediate assistance if your car ignition switch is damaged. An automotive locksmith will have the tools and lubrication to carefully remove your broken key from the ignition. This is a far more effective method to deal with the issue than simply trying to jiggle your key around. A professional will also ensure the broken part isn't stuck inside the ignition cylinder, which can cause further damage.

An ignition cylinder is the mechanism that fits your key and allows your engine to start, turn on other electrical components, and so on. These cylinders may break down as a result of normal wear and tear, or accidental damage. An autolocksmith is in a position to repair or replace the cylinder, and restore the functionality of your vehicle.

A professional locksmith can diagnose the issue, and give an estimate of the cost prior to starting the work. The ignition cylinders can be expensive but they're worth the cost for a reliable and safe vehicle.

It's important to remember that the majority of ignition issues don't have anything to do with the ignition switch itself. The most frequent problems our locksmiths encounter are loose fittings, stiff keys that aren't turning, or ignitions that aren't turning at all. A locksmith can tell you if the problem is with the car's other components.

Car Key Replacement

It can be a huge problem to lose or lose your keys to your car, especially when you're in a hurry. That's why it's important to have at least one spare set with you - you don't know when you'll require them. It's also why it's an excellent idea to contact an auto locksmith in NYC in the event that you have lost or broken your key. It's a lot cheaper than calling roadside assistance and waiting for them to come to your rescue.

The type of key that you have will determine much it costs to replace it. Keys that are traditional, simple pieces of metal that fit into mechanical locks and ignitions, are usually the most affordable to replace. They are also the easiest to crack. Key fobs, which have buttons on the outside which you press to unlock and lock your vehicle Locksmith, and remote keys, that let you start or lock your vehicle from a distance they are more expensive.

Most of these keys require assistance from an auto locksmith to have an updated copy. To accomplish this the locksmith must know the year, model and make of your car, as well as evidence that you own the car (the title or registration is sufficient).

Some dealers might permit you to have a new key programmed by someone else but it can be an inconvenience. It is a good idea to consult with your dealer prior to making a decision to go elsewhere for this service, but be aware that the dealership is likely to charge more than a locksmith who is independent.
